A rare alms collection box for the Women's Work branch of the Methodist Missionary Society, dating to approximately 1932 when this branch was formed. The box is simply made of wood with a coin slot in the top, and a hinged opening in the base. The sides and top are covered with attractive chromolithographed paper labels. The sides show female missionaries undertaking various activities in far-flung parts of the world, each with an appropriate title illustrating the range of work carried out by Women's Work. 'Preach the Gospel' shows a missionary reading from the Bible; 'Heal the Sick' shows a woman nursing a patient; 'Teach the Nations' shows a woman working in a classroom. The back panel is entitled 'Suffer Little Children to Come unto Me' and shows a missionary reading to two children. The top bears the original Women's Work slogan 'Lighted to Lighten'. These boxes continued in use for many years - this one was last used in 1964 as evidenced by the remains of the last paper label sealing the bottom, when Mrs Brown collected 10/- during the 1st quarter!



This collection box has been well used and there is commensurate wear and some soiling to the paper labels.
